Meta plans to increase the prices of its Quest 2 headsets to $400 for 128GB and $500 for 256GB on August 1, and bundle Beat Saber for free through December 31

The price for a new Quest 2 is jumping to $399 as Meta says “the costs to make and ship our products have been on the rise.”
